Output d0c18371b8d2a8e47983e3d81b6c9f5890f8a95620a43873b78f6e49f9e9df58:159

value
107561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dd56500fc1f87ac3313312d9a64a8a43621569 OP_EQUAL
address
34sN3qkmVhQ5dNm8qJSDWk4MgisE2xcUF5
transaction
d0c18371b8d2a8e47983e3d81b6c9f5890f8a95620a43873b78f6e49f9e9df58